Connectors
==========
JP1 External Battery connector is used for the external battery.
This is use when internal battery is not conected.
JP27 Turbo switch connector will be connected to the turbo switch
of your computer case. This is used to toggle the system
speed between fast and slow processing speed.
JP26 Reset switch connector will be connected to the reset switch of
your computer case. Resetting the system, it will restart the
computer from self-test without turning off the power supply.
This connection is always in OFF position.
JP28 Turbo LED connector will be connected to the turbo LED of
your computer case. The LED will light up when the systen is
running in high processing speed. (Note the positive and nega-
tive of the LED)
JP29 Keylock and Power LED connector will be connected to your
computer case. Keylock is used to lock the keyboard. Power
LED will light up when you turn on your power supply.
JP30 Speaker connector will be connected to the speaker of your
computer case.
P1,P2 Power Supply connector is connected from the output of the
power supply. Most of the power supply has two connectors
which will be connected to the main board. Each connector
has six wires, two of the wires are black. To connect to the
main board, make sure that the black wires is in the middle.
Wrong connection will cause damage of the main board.
J1 Keyboard connector. This is used for inputting signal from
the keyboard.
Memory Configuration
====================
The system board Memory can be expanded from IMB to 64MB.Mem-
ory can be installed by using 256K, 1M, 4M and 16M SIMM RAM
Module.
